gertk | 0:28557a4d2215 | 37 | /* |
gertk | 0:28557a4d2215 | 38 | |
gertk | 0:28557a4d2215 | 39 | timeouts: |
gertk | 0:28557a4d2215 | 40 | |
gertk | 0:28557a4d2215 | 41 | C code for testing with ints: |
gertk | 0:28557a4d2215 | 42 | |
gertk | 0:28557a4d2215 | 43 | unsigned int timeout; |
gertk | 0:28557a4d2215 | 44 | timeout=4000; |
gertk | 0:28557a4d2215 | 45 | PORT_DIRECTION=OUTPUT; |
gertk | 0:28557a4d2215 | 46 | while(1) |
gertk | 0:28557a4d2215 | 47 | { |
gertk | 0:28557a4d2215 | 48 | PORT=1; |
gertk | 0:28557a4d2215 | 49 | timeout=8000; |
gertk | 0:28557a4d2215 | 50 | while(timeout-- >= 1); //60ms @ 8Mhz, opt on, 72ms @ 8Mhz, opt off |
gertk | 0:28557a4d2215 | 51 | PORT=0; |
gertk | 0:28557a4d2215 | 52 | } |
gertk | 0:28557a4d2215 | 53 | |
gertk | 0:28557a4d2215 | 54 | Time taken: optimisations on: 16cyc/number loop, 8us @ 8Mhz |
gertk | 0:28557a4d2215 | 55 | optimisations off: 18cyc/number loop, 9us @ 8Mhz |
gertk | 0:28557a4d2215 | 56 | with extra check ie: && (RB7==1), +3cyc/number loop, +1.5us @ 8Mhz |
gertk | 0:28557a4d2215 | 57 | |
gertk | 0:28557a4d2215 | 58 | C code for testing with chars: |
gertk | 0:28557a4d2215 | 59 | |
gertk | 0:28557a4d2215 | 60 | similar to above |
gertk | 0:28557a4d2215 | 61 | |
gertk | 0:28557a4d2215 | 62 | Time taken: optimisations on: 9cyc/number loop, 4.5us @ 8Mhz |
gertk | 0:28557a4d2215 | 63 | with extra check ie: && (RB7==1), +3cyc/number loop, +1.5us @ 8Mhz |
gertk | 0:28557a4d2215 | 64 | |
gertk | 0:28557a4d2215 | 65 | Formula: rough timeout value = (<us desired>/<cycles per loop>) * (PIC_CLK/4.0) |
gertk | 0:28557a4d2215 | 66 | |
gertk | 0:28557a4d2215 | 67 | To use: //for max timeout of 1147us @ 8Mhz |
gertk | 0:28557a4d2215 | 68 | #define LOOP_CYCLES_CHAR 9 //how many cycles per loop, optimizations on |
gertk | 0:28557a4d2215 | 69 | #define timeout_char_us(x) (unsigned char)((x/LOOP_CYCLES_CHAR)*(PIC_CLK/4.0)) |
gertk | 0:28557a4d2215 | 70 | unsigned char timeout; |
gertk | 0:28557a4d2215 | 71 | timeout=timeout_char_us(1147); //max timeout allowed @ 8Mhz, 573us @ 16Mhz |
gertk | 0:28557a4d2215 | 72 | while((timeout-- >= 1) && (<extra condition>)); //wait |
gertk | 0:28557a4d2215 | 73 | |
gertk | 0:28557a4d2215 | 74 | To use: //for max 491512us, half sec timeout @ 8Mhz |
gertk | 0:28557a4d2215 | 75 | #define LOOP_CYCLES_INT 16 //how many cycles per loop, optimizations on |
gertk | 0:28557a4d2215 | 76 | #define timeout_int_us(x) (unsigned int)((x+/LOOP_CYCLES_INT)*(PIC_CLK/4.0)) |
gertk | 0:28557a4d2215 | 77 | unsigned int timeout; |
gertk | 0:28557a4d2215 | 78 | timeout=timeout_int_us(491512); //max timeout allowed @ 8Mhz |
gertk | 0:28557a4d2215 | 79 | while((timeout-- >= 1) && (<extra condition>)); //wait |
gertk | 0:28557a4d2215 | 80 | */ |
